What Are the Standard Dimensions of a Carry On Size Suitcase?

The standard dimensions for a carry-on size suitcase typically adhere to airline regulations, which can vary, but there are generally accepted sizes that travelers should consider.

  • 22 x 14 x 9 inches: This dimension is the most common standard for many airlines, including major carriers like American Airlines and Delta. It allows for the suitcase to fit in the overhead compartment while still being compact enough for easy maneuverability.
  • 20 x 14 x 9 inches: Slightly smaller than the common standard, this size is often acceptable for regional or budget airlines that have stricter carry-on policies. It offers the advantage of fitting into tighter spaces, making it a good choice for travelers who prefer not to check their luggage.
  • 21 x 13 x 8 inches: This size is ideal for international travel, as many international airlines tend to have different standards. It provides ample packing space while ensuring compliance with various carry-on regulations across different airlines.
  • Maximum Weight Limit: In addition to dimensions, many airlines have a maximum weight limit for carry-on luggage, typically ranging from 15 to 25 pounds. Adhering to these weight limits is crucial to avoid additional fees or having to check the bag at the gate.
  • Expandable Options: Some carry-on suitcases feature an expandable design that allows travelers to increase packing capacity when necessary. While this can be useful, it’s important to remember that expanded luggage may not fit within the standard size restrictions of all airlines.

What Key Features Should You Consider When Choosing a Carry On Size Suitcase?

When choosing the best carry-on size suitcase, several key features are essential to enhance travel convenience and compliance with airline regulations.

  • Dimensions: Check the airline’s carry-on size restrictions, which typically range from 22″ x 14″ x 9″ to 24″ x 16″ x 10″. Adhering to these dimensions ensures your suitcase will fit in overhead compartments or under the seat, avoiding any unexpected fees or the need to check your bag.
  • Weight: Opt for a lightweight design, as many airlines impose weight limits on carry-on luggage. A lighter suitcase allows you to maximize packing capacity without exceeding weight restrictions, making it easier to maneuver through airports.
  • Durability: Look for materials such as polycarbonate or ballistic nylon that can withstand the rigors of travel. A durable suitcase not only protects your belongings but also ensures longevity, reducing the need for frequent replacements.
  • Wheels: Choose between two-wheeled or four-wheeled (spinner) suitcases, depending on your preference for maneuverability. Spinner suitcases offer 360-degree mobility, making it easier to navigate crowded spaces, while two-wheeled options may provide more stability on uneven surfaces.
  • Compartments: Evaluate the internal organization features, such as pockets and dividers, to keep your items neatly arranged. A well-organized suitcase allows for easy access to essentials and can help prevent damage to delicate items during transit.
  • Security Features: Consider suitcases with built-in locks or the ability to secure with TSA-approved locks. These features provide peace of mind by protecting your belongings from theft while still allowing TSA agents to inspect your bag if necessary.
  • Style and Design: Select a design that reflects your personal style while also considering visibility and ease of identification. Bright colors or unique patterns can help your suitcase stand out on the baggage carousel, reducing the risk of mix-ups.
  • Expandability: Some carry-on suitcases offer expandable zippers that allow for additional packing space. This feature can be especially useful for returning from trips with souvenirs or extra items, providing flexibility without requiring a larger suitcase.

What Materials Are Best for Durability and Lightweight Carry On Suitcases?

The best materials for durability and lightweight carry-on suitcases include:

  • Polycarbonate: This high-tech plastic is known for its excellent impact resistance and lightweight nature, making it a popular choice for modern carry-on suitcases. Polycarbonate suitcases can withstand harsh conditions without cracking, ensuring your belongings remain safe during travel.
  • Aluminum: While on the heavier side, aluminum offers unmatched durability and a sleek aesthetic. Its robust construction can withstand significant wear and tear, making it ideal for frequent travelers who need a suitcase that will last for years.
  • Nylon: Often used for soft-sided suitcases, nylon is lightweight, flexible, and resistant to abrasions and tears. High-denier nylon is particularly durable, providing a good balance between weight and strength, making it suitable for various travel conditions.
  • Ballistic Nylon: An even tougher variant of nylon, ballistic nylon is made to resist punctures and tears, making it an excellent choice for heavy-duty carry-on suitcases. This material is often used in military gear, ensuring that bags made from it can withstand rigorous travel demands.
  • Polyester: Lightweight and cost-effective, polyester is commonly used in budget-friendly carry-on suitcases. While not as durable as nylon, high-quality polyester can still provide decent water resistance and protection for your belongings.
  • ABS (Acrylonitrile Butadiene Styrene): This thermoplastic is lightweight and inexpensive, making it a common choice for affordable hard-shell suitcases. While not as durable as polycarbonate, ABS offers decent protection against impacts for travelers on a budget.

Which Brands Are Renowned for Producing the Best Carry On Size Suitcases?

Some of the most renowned brands for producing the best carry on size suitcases include:

  • Samsonite: Known for its durability and innovative designs, Samsonite offers a range of carry on suitcases that cater to frequent travelers. Their products often feature lightweight materials, 360-degree spinner wheels, and spacious interiors with organized compartments.
  • Travelpro: Originally designed for airline professionals, Travelpro suitcases are celebrated for their functional design and reliability. Their carry on options typically include features like high-performance wheels and a dedicated laptop compartment, making them ideal for business travelers.
  • Rimowa: Rimowa is synonymous with luxury and style, offering premium carry on suitcases made from aluminum and polycarbonate. The brand’s iconic designs combine elegance with strength, featuring smooth-rolling wheels and a distinctive grooved exterior that stands out in any airport.
  • Briggs & Riley: This brand is well-regarded for its lifetime warranty and commitment to quality craftsmanship. Briggs & Riley carry on suitcases often include a unique expansion feature that allows for extra packing space without compromising stability.
  • American Tourister: Known for its fun and vibrant designs, American Tourister provides budget-friendly carry on suitcases that do not compromise on quality. Their products typically feature lightweight constructions and ample organization options, making them perfect for casual travelers and families.
  • Away: Away has gained popularity for its modern aesthetics and practical features, including built-in USB chargers and a durable hard shell. Their carry on suitcases are designed with the tech-savvy traveler in mind, offering smart storage solutions and a sleek appearance.
  • TUMI: TUMI is a premium brand known for its sophisticated designs and exceptional durability. Their carry on suitcases often come equipped with advanced features such as TUMI Tracer, a unique program that helps recover lost luggage, as well as high-quality materials that withstand the rigors of travel.

What Price Range Should You Expect for Quality Carry On Size Suitcases?

The price range for quality carry-on size suitcases can vary significantly based on brand, materials, and features.

  • Budget Range ($50 – $100): This category includes basic carry-on suitcases that are functional but may lack advanced features.
  • Mid-Range ($100 – $250): Mid-range options typically offer better materials, more durability, and added features such as spinner wheels and organizational compartments.
  • Premium Range ($250 – $500): Premium suitcases are usually made from high-quality materials, come with extensive warranties, and may feature innovative designs and technology like built-in charging ports.
  • Luxury Range ($500 and above): Luxury carry-ons are crafted by high-end brands and may include bespoke materials, unique designs, and are often associated with status, providing both functionality and aesthetic appeal.

In the budget range, you can find basic models that are lightweight and easy to maneuver, making them suitable for short trips or infrequent travelers. However, they may not withstand rough handling or offer the best durability over time.

Mid-range suitcases generally provide a balance of quality and price, often incorporating features like water-resistant materials, better zipper systems, and a variety of colors and styles. These suitcases are ideal for regular travelers who want reliability without breaking the bank.

Premium suitcases stand out with their robust construction and thoughtful design elements, such as enhanced security features and premium wheels for smooth rolling. They cater to frequent flyers who seek both durability and style in their travel gear.

Finally, luxury suitcases not only offer exceptional craftsmanship and materials but also a sense of exclusivity that comes with high-end brands. They are designed for travelers who prioritize aesthetics and brand prestige, often at a significant price point.
